Sorry, I should have added that I don't want to protect the sheet. Reasoning is that ocassionally we want to overwrite the formula for some special reason. Weeks or months later, someone opens the worksheet and revises a couple of numbers, but they forgot they overwrote one formula so now things aren't calculating correctly.
When might this happen? We're competitively bidding a project and add a certain percentage to the estimated costs for our markup to get to our TOTAL BID. When we need to give our bid breakdown, we want our fee spread proportionately throughout the breakdown, but we also want all numbers rounded to nearest dollar. If numerous numbers are rounded down, the breakdown doesn't match the TOTAL BID. Therefore prior to distributing the breakdown, we change one or two numbers manually. I want to be able to easily see what numbers I manually entered over the formula.
So, I was wondering if someone might know of a way to write a conditional format, that if the cell didn't contain a formula, I would get certain formatting.
